Understanding Roller Diameter in Stainless Steel Agricultural Chains
The roller diameter of a chain refers to the diameter of the cylindrical rollers that make up the chain. These rollers are designed to rotate freely and engage with the sprockets, facilitating smooth motion and power transmission. The roller diameter directly influences the overall functionality and durability of the chain, making it a critical consideration in agricultural operations.
Enhanced Load Distribution and Wear Resistance
A larger roller diameter in stainless steel agricultural chains offers several advantages. Firstly, it improves load distribution across the chain, reducing stress on individual components. This enhanced load distribution minimizes the risk of premature wear and elongation, leading to prolonged chain life and improved performance in demanding agricultural conditions.
Reduced Friction and Energy Consumption
With a larger roller diameter, stainless steel agricultural chains experience reduced friction as they engage with the sprockets. This reduction in friction translates into lower energy consumption, allowing agricultural machinery to operate more efficiently. By reducing power losses, chains with optimized roller diameter contribute to increased fuel efficiency and cost savings for farmers.
Enhanced Strength and Breaking Load
The roller diameter also affects the strength and breaking load capacity of stainless steel agricultural chains. Larger rollers provide increased contact area with the sprockets, distributing the load more evenly and reducing the risk of chain failure under heavy loads. This enhanced strength ensures reliable performance and prevents downtime due to chain breakage, which is crucial for farmers aiming for uninterrupted productivity.
